来自cj的js练手
文章平均质量分 75
名字到底多长
算法题来自大神的博客:http://blog.csdn.net/v_JULY_v?viewmode=contents
展开
-
js之表格api:99乘法表
table: insertRow 返回插入的row rows属性 row: insertCell 返回插入的cell cells属性 window.onload =function(){ var inputs = document.getElementsByTagName("input"); inputs[2].onclick =function(evt){原创 2012-10-31 21:05:55 · 1342 阅读 · 0 评论 -
js之排序表格
SortableTable window.onload = function(){ var s = new SortableTable(document.getElementById('xxx')); //s.sortByCol(1,1); } /** 该表格表格头放在thead里面,所有交互操作通过表格头实现 要排序的行放在tbody里面原创 2012-11-01 18:19:17 · 1018 阅读 · 0 评论 -
js之图片数字时钟
Digit Clock window.onload = function(){ new DigitalClock(document.getElementById('digitClock')); }; function DigitalClock(container) { this.container = container; var xx = this.原创 2012-11-02 21:00:27 · 3849 阅读 · 0 评论 -
js1:滚动的文字
//不能直接传属性,不然设置值的时候会被覆盖掉 function ScrollText(s,o,attr,t){ //s:滚动的文本 // 文本设置的对象 //attr:文本设置到某个对象的哪个属性上 //t 每个滚动时间,默认值为1000 this.s = s; this.o = o; this.attr = attr; this.t = t || 100原创 2012-10-25 21:46:11 · 382 阅读 · 0 评论 -
透明度变化和所有px为单位的运动
/** 只能用于style属性 只能用于px css中没有设置过初始值貌似不行 */ function animate(o,attr,add,start,end,t){ //o 动画的对象 //attr 对象的style属性中要变化的对应属性 //t 时间间隔 //add 每次增加或者减少的量 //start 开始值 //end 结束值 //t 变化时间间隔,原创 2012-10-26 22:33:51 · 1135 阅读 · 0 评论 -
js之自定义封装ajax类
//open("get",url),url要加Math.random() //send()发送请求,post的时候传入字符串参数,歧义值用encodeURIComponent //onreadystatechange readystate==4数据返回\status==200 //responseText responseXML得到一个xml对象,dom核心方法访问 //s原创 2012-11-05 21:03:50 · 1393 阅读 · 0 评论 -
js解析xml封装类
function XmlDom(){ if(document.implementation&&document.implementation.createDocument){//w3c //第一个参数命名空间;第二个参数根节点 this.xmlDom = document.implementation.createDocument("","",null); this.type原创 2012-11-07 15:33:05 · 1026 阅读 · 0 评论